She was named Female Para Star for 2013 at the inaugural International Table Tennis Federation [ITTF] Star Awards. (ittf.com, 11 Jan 2014)

General
CANCER DIAGNOSIS
In January 2019 she was diagnosed with breast cancer, and in March that year underwent a mastectomy on her right breast. She resumed competing one month after the surgery. "It has been important for me not to be defined by cancer or multiple sclerosis. I'm Anna-Carin. I live with these conditions but my personality has not changed, it is the same as it was before I ended up in a wheelchair. I am the same person but with a little more experience of some things I would rather have escaped. I realised that male table tennis players have a big advantage because you reach much better when you do not have a breast. One of my national teammates said to me, 'Have your arms grown longer, Anna-Carin?'" (anna-carinahlquist.se, 20 Jan 2021; svt.se, 16 Sep 2019)
